As a very small K-5 school in Polson, Montana, Valley View School instructs 35 students from grades pre-K through 6, operated by Valley View Elem. Enrollment runs roughly 79% smaller than the state mean of about 167.
Valley View School is a school of Valley View Elem, the district that handles curriculum, staffing, and budget for the campus.
For racial and ethnic makeup, Valley View School shows that nearly all students (80%) are White. The remainder reads as 14% multiracial, 3% Hispanic, 3% Pacific Islander. That is meaningfully more White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 66%.
On the income-and-resources front, On paper, Valley View School has 4 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 8.8: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 11.9:1, putting Valley View School tighter than the state norm the norm. About 9%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. Set against Lake County (around 83%), the school's rate is meaningfully below typical.
In the area at large, census data for Lake County shows the typical household earns roughly $63,360 per year, 32%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 12%. In all, Lake County runs 21 public schools (combined enrollment of about 4,302 students), of which Valley View School is one.
Nearest neighbor: Polson High School, around 6.3 miles off. Within ten miles, there are 6 other public schools, a sparser pattern than typical urban areas.
Geographically, the school is in a small-town area.
Trend over the last 7 years.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Valley View School has rose 25%, going from 28 students in 2018 to 35 in 2025. White enrollment moved from 89% to 80% across the same window.
